Humboldt and Douglas County Republicans Endorse Drew Johnson for State Treasurer
Support for Johnson continues to grow across rural Nevada.
August 26, 2026
LAS VEGAS – Drew Johnson, Republican candidate for Nevada State Treasurer, announced today that he has earned the endorsements of the Humboldt County Republican Central Committee and the Douglas County Republican Central Committee.
The endorsements demonstrate continued support for Johnson’s campaign among Republican grassroots organizations across Nevada.
“I’m incredibly grateful to the Republicans in Humboldt and Douglas counties for their support,” Johnson said. “Nevada is much bigger than Las Vegas and Carson City, and our statewide elected officials need to understand and represent communities in every corner of the state.”
